#7d0c01 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#7d0c01 is composed of 49% red, 4.7% green and 0.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 90.4% magenta, 99.2% yellow and 51% black. It has a hue angle of 5.3 degrees, a saturation of 98.4% and a lightness of 24.7%. #7d0c01 color hex could be obtained by blending #fa1802 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660000.

#7d0c01 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#7d0c01 has RGB values of R:125, G:12, B:1 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.9, Y:0.99, K:0.51. Its decimal value is 8195073.

Shades and Tints of #7d0c01
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#080100 is the darkest color, while #fff5f4 is the lightest one.

Tones of #7d0c01
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#433c3b is the less saturated color, while #7d0c01 is the most saturated one.
